FAQs

What materials can I use these brushes on?

The Shoestring Shoe Brush Kit is generally suitable for leather, synthetic materials, and canvas. Always perform a spot test with any cleaning or polishing products on an inconspicuous area first.

How do I use the three different applicators?

Typically, one applicator is for initial cleaning or applying a renovating agent, another for applying polish or cream, and the horsehair brush is for final buffing and achieving a shine.

Can I use these brushes with any shoe polish?

Yes, the brushes are designed to work with most standard shoe polishes, creams, and waxes. The horsehair brush is particularly effective for buffing out polishes.

How do I clean the polishing cloth?

The polishing cloth can usually be hand-washed with mild soap and water and then air-dried. Check the cloth's material for specific care instructions.

Is this kit suitable for heavy-duty cleaning?

This kit is best suited for light dirt removal and routine polishing. For heavily soiled or stained shoes, you may need to use specialized cleaners before employing this kit.

What is the benefit of the horsehair brush?

The 100% quality horsehair brush is ideal for applying a final polish and buffing, helping to create a smooth, high-gloss finish without damaging the shoe's surface.

Troubleshooting

Brush bristles are splayed or damaged

This can occur with heavy use. For light splaying, try reshaping the bristles after cleaning. For significant damage, replacement of the brush may be necessary.

Polishing cloth is not effective

Ensure the cloth is clean and free of debris. For best results, use with appropriate shoe polish or finishing spray. Wash the cloth if it has accumulated too much product.

Dirt is too heavy for the brushes

The brushes are designed for light dirt. For heavy mud or stains, pre-clean with water or a specialized cleaner before using the kit.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up: The Shoestring Shoe Brush Kit requires no setup; it is ready to use straight out of the packaging. Ensure you have your preferred shoe cleaning and polishing products on hand.

Compatibility: This kit is compatible with a wide range of footwear materials, including leather, synthetic leather, and canvas. Always test cleaning products on an inconspicuous area first, especially on delicate materials.

Care: After each use, tap the brushes gently to remove loose dirt and polish residue. Store the kit in a dry place. The polishing cloth can be washed separately according to its material care instructions (typically hand wash or delicate machine wash). Avoid immersing the wooden or plastic handles in water for extended periods to prevent damage.
